setMacroChars doesnt work properly #2794

Open
@DanCvejn

Description

Describe the problem

When you use setMacroChars funtion, it wont find any variables in word file or with xml tags so setValues after that wont work. I have tried to change constructor code a bit by adding option to set macroChars in inicialization. After that change it works how it should.

Part that I edited:

 /**
 * @since 0.12.0 Throws CreateTemporaryFileException and CopyFileException instead of Exception
 *
 * @param string $documentTemplate The fully qualified template filename
 * @param string $macroOpeningChars Custom macro opening characters
 * @param string $macroClosingChars Custom macro closing characters
 */
 public function __construct($documentTemplate, $macroOpeningChars = null, $macroClosingChars = null)
 {
 if ($macroOpeningChars) {
 self::$macroOpeningChars = $macroOpeningChars;
 }
 if ($macroClosingChars) {
 self::$macroClosingChars = $macroClosingChars;
 }

Describe the expected behavior

When I have changed it, I get all wanted variables it file.
